What is the purpose of a consultation form?

The purpose of a consultation form is to understand client needs and preferences for services. This form serves as a foundational tool in the service industry, particularly in cosmetology, enabling professionals to gather essential information about a client’s expectations, desired outcomes, and any specific requests they may have. By effectively utilizing this form, and the feedback provided by clients, practitioners can tailor their services to meet individual preferences, ensuring greater satisfaction and a more personalized experience. Gathering this information upfront is critical in establishing trust and rapport with clients, as well as in making informed decisions about how to proceed with treatments or services.

In contrast, while maintaining client records, listing available products, and providing pricing details are also important aspects of salon management, they do not directly relate to the primary purpose of the consultation form, which is focused on understanding client needs and preferences.
